This lecture overviews Graph Neural Networks that has many applications in Deep Learning, Signal and Video Analysis, Network Theory, Web Science and Social Media Analytics. It covers the following topics in detail: Introduction to Graphs. Neural Networks. Graph Convolutional Networks (GCN). Recurrent Graph Neural Networks (RGNN). Graph Auto-Encoders. Spatial-Temporal Graph Neural Networks. GNN Applications.